Red Mod - patient positioning and abbreves

QuestionAnswer
Lying on back, face upward, legs strait, feet raised 30 degrees, drape covers whole body Trendelenberg - used for shock, low blood pressure, abdominal surgery
lying face down, arms under head, legs strait, drape over whole body Prone - posterior exam, back surgery, heel surgery, radiological reports
On right side, right arm and shoulder drawn back, behind body. left leg is flexed upward drape under arms to below knees Sims - rectal exam, rectal thermometer reading, pelvic and perineal exams
face down, head at side, on knees, legs apart, arms under head, chest on table knee-chest - proctological exam, sigmoid, rectal exam, hemorrhoid, anal and perineal exam
lying on back, knees sharply flexed, buttocks on edge of table, feet in stirrups lithotomy - vaginal exam, pap smear, pubic, pelvic, and genital exam
lying on back, knees flexed, feet flat on table dorsal recumbant - rectal, vaginal, perineal exam, abdominal exam, digital exam of vagina and rectum
sitting, legs strait, upper body on 90 degree angle/ 45 degree angle Fowler's / Semi-Fowler's - head, neck and chest exam & treatment, pt who have difficulty breathing when laying down, posturgical examination, head trauma or pain
